The LabVIEW UX is poor when using high DPI screens. I would agree that Windows is partly to blame initially, but there are newer design guidelines that solve this and they have been around for >3 years. The application should be DPI aware and act accordingly. For a > £4000 piece of software I expect more...
All of the text and graphics are blurry when it should be sharp with no end-user way to correct this.
Non Windows mouse cursors are tiny.
Some of the blurry text and graphics highlighted in red. Notice how the title bar text and other Windows' applications are sharp.
